Real Madrid officials are trying to make sense of Cristiano Ronaldo's outburst, complete with an explicit wish to leave the club.
A Real Madrid high official who asked to remain unnamed said on Monday that Ronaldo's outburst was "whimsical and ill-timed". The source confirmed that Ronaldo wants to leave, but noted that "nobody knows why".
Ronaldo did not celebrate his goals on Sunday.
"I do not celebrate my goals when I am sad. I am sad due to a professional issue that the club knows about. That is why I was not celebrating," he said afterwards.
"I am not happy, the people here know why. I am not going to talk more about this, there are more important things."
Club sources said that the winger did not even give president Florentino Perez more specific reasons when the two met Saturday at the player's request.
"Everything has come by surprise," a Real Madrid source said.
"It all comes with a two-week break for national team duty, and just a few days after winning the Spanish Supercup against Barcelona.
"Nobody even remembers that and we should be partying still."
Ronaldo's agent, Jorge Mendes, said in a statement that he knows why the player feels this way, but he also declined to say why.
"It is up to Cristiano Ronaldo himself to disclose (these reasons) or not, as he sees fit," Mendes said.
He said he was "not surprised" by Ronaldo's comments.
"Anyone who knows the relationship I have with Cristiano Ronaldo knows he will always have my full solidarity," Mendes said.
